2011-11-28 4 views
17

私はこの質問が何度もこのサイトで何度か尋ねられてきたことを知っていますが、私が見たすべてのことをしても、私の人生のためにはNode.JSや効率的な使い方ができませんそれが何のために良いのかを知ることができます。私はNode.JS、任意のリソース、チュートリアルを理解することができません。

私は自分自身を高度なJavaScript開発者だと考えています。私は単にjQueryやPrototypeを知っているのではなく、基本的な言語をかなりよく知っています。結局のところ、サーバ側のJavaScriptであるNode.JSを学ぶためには、私の理解から本当に必要です。

私はWindowsマシンで開発しましたが、Node.JSアプリケーションを開発するためにVirtualboxとUbuntu Server ISOをインストールしました。私はどこから始めるのですか?私は言語を知っていますが、今は何ですか?アプリケーションがどのように書かれているのか分かりません。

GeddyやExpressのようなNode.JS用のフレームワークを使用しているか、Node.JSを学習してからフレームワークを検討すべきか、もう1つ質問します。

答えて

10

Node Beginnerが優れた出発点であることがわかりました。

+0

を開始すべきかのフレームワークとモジュールで行きます。私のGoogle-Fuは、今回私には本当に失敗しました。私はこのサイトを見つけられませんでしたが、実際には完全なチュートリアルと断片化された情報が見つかりました。私はその本を上から下へと勉強します。ありがとう、マイケル。 –

3

このプロジェクトの時間が限られている場合は、フレームワークに直接ジャンプする必要があります。作業しているツールをより深く理解したい場合は、ベアボーンのチュートリアル(Expressj、バックボーンなどのフレームワークをほとんど使用しない)から始めてください。私はNode Beginnerが最良の出発点であることも発見したので、Michael Stumの助言を受けてください。

これらのフレームワークの使用を開始すると、各行が実際に何をしているかを理解することができます。

+0

私はデッドラインなどでそれを使用したいプロジェクトはありません。私はちょうど好奇心が強い/何か新しいことを学びたいと思っていました。 Node.JSは数年後にはデファクトではないかもしれませんが、サーバー側のJavaScriptのコンパイルとコーディングが実際に遅かれ早かれ離陸しようとしていることは確かです。 –

2

私は本当にただnodejs.orgサイト自体のドキュメントを見てお勧めします...

概要およびビデオhttp://nodejs.org/docs/latest/ と長すぎると読む価値がないAPI Manualを参照してください... 。

はい、私はあなたが最初に基本から始めることを示唆し、以降はthisあなたはすごいポイント